Geocache Description:

Lancelot 'Capability' Brown was commissioned in 1758 to create this serpentine shaped lake from the existing body of water. Ducks, geese and swans are regularly on this lake.

This is a circuit of approximately 2.5 miles in and around Langley Park.  

Langley Park is Grade 2 listed parkland and has a variety of habitats for wildlife, including woodland, heathland and grassland.  A variety of wildfowl can be seen on Langley Lake and the Arboretum has year round interest.  From a royal hunting ground to extravagant pleasure gardens, the park offers great history and features.
